We're often asked by parents when they should bring their child in for their first orthodontic assessment.
We recommend bringing your child in for their first orthodontic consultation around age 7 even if there are no visible issues. Early assessment means we can guide your child’s smile in the right direction.
At this early stage, we’re not just checking teeth. We’re also assessing:
✅ Early signs of crowding or bite problems
✅️ Bite and jaw development
✅ Crowding or spacing issues
✅ Airway and breathing concerns (like mouth breathing, snoring, or sleep disturbances)
